Ordinals
beta
Address 1PqcmVMbLXVHfQxX3dVn6AWs33tDYYLfoX
sat balance
256150
runes balances
outputs
cea480195badf93e2edc25220568b39039069fe6683dd9a43d5a06ff710054e7:0